Output d15e89aba8a23d76b2d1e5fefda2823f5da982515214a2d6e2e67df8fcfb6fcd:1

value
151600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86d33a1e93dfd783b6a4f6f1cf7cfd4937664389 OP_EQUALVERIFY OP_CHECKSIG
address
1DHtb1xg27qpc9qXpAt8n8piD5Jc2CiyJX
transaction
d15e89aba8a23d76b2d1e5fefda2823f5da982515214a2d6e2e67df8fcfb6fcd
confirmations
444965
spent
true